Medicinal mushrooms with immunostimulating and antitumor properties (II)

Mushrooms have been an integral part of diet and medicinal practices since ancient times. In ancient Chinese culture, they were valued for both their nutritional properties and medicinal benefits. The first book on remedies belonging to the Chinese civilization mentions the therapeutic effects of various species of mushrooms. In the last three decades, researchers from all over the world, especially from countries such as Japan, China, Korea, the USA and Canada, have conducted numerous studies that have confirmed the beneficial effects of mushrooms on human health. These studies have highlighted their immunological, antioxidant, anti-tumor, and anti-inflammatory properties. The discovery of penicillin in 1928, derived from the mold Penicillium notatum (a lower fungus), was a watershed moment in medical history, revolutionizing the treatment of bacterial infections and saving millions of lives. This discovery also opened doors for the synthesis of other exceptional drugs. Over the past three decades, interest in medicinal mushrooms and their therapeutic properties has grown significantly. These mushrooms have been studied for their potential in treating immunological conditions and cancer. Thus, medicinal mushrooms have become the subject of intensive research in the field of complementary medicine.
